Transaction 66713ea183a12d404623804e924edab80c1a0f1979ba41b203f100da2e61ba2f

1 Input
2 Outputs
  • 66713ea183a12d404623804e924edab80c1a0f1979ba41b203f100da2e61ba2f:0
  • value  208935
    address  3DdpUcCT56trWSmmVzJGCZV6VL58Mk12Pz
  • 66713ea183a12d404623804e924edab80c1a0f1979ba41b203f100da2e61ba2f:1
  • value  1291000
    address  38ftDoLsD3cZycdVwTsQf49EEwQNiuNCdV